Centerville has a population of 684, which is below the state average. This suggests a smaller and more localized community environment.
The median household income in Centerville is $48,114, which is below the state average, indicating moderate economic conditions.
The average housing price in Centerville is about $118,114, making it relatively affordable compared to many cities in New York.
The unemployment rate in Centerville is 6.00%, slightly above the state average, suggesting moderate employment conditions. Crime rates in Centerville are higher than the state average, which may be a factor for residents to consider.
